THE FIVE SOLAS
If you're wondering about the picture I have at the top of my page, it is the Five Solas. I learned about the Five Solas a couple years ago when I was just beginning to learn about the Doctrines of Grace and Election. They are:
Sola Scriptura--Scripture Alone
Sola Gratia--Grace Alone
Sola Fide--Faith Alone
Solus Christus--Christ Alone
Soli Deo Gloria--To the Glory of God Alone
When speaking of Salvation, this is how it reads: Salvation comes to us through Scripture alone, by Grace alone, through Faith alone, in Christ alone, to the glory of God alone. Man does NOTHING. Christ died for our sins, the Holy Spirit illuminates our minds and gives us understanding of our sinful nature and convicts us of our sins, and God gives us the grace and faith to believe.
Forget all the "free will" stuff. We can't be saved through our will because our will isn't free. The Bible says we are "slaves" to sin. If we are slaves how can we be free?? Being a slave means we obey the master who has control over us. In this case, our master is sin. And what slave can just decide to leave his/her master when they want? They can't. The only way a slave can be freed from their master is if someone comes and buys/redeems their freedom. That is why the Bible says that Christ is our Redeemer. He bought us out of slavery to sin because He paid the price for our sin when He took our punishment on the cross.
The Bible also calls us "Trophies of Grace". I never understood the concept of this term until I heard a sermon by Jeff Noblit. When a athlete/team wins a championship title, they are given a trophy. That trophy is the reward for THEIR hard work and dedication to accomplishing their goal. They put that trophy on display for everyone to see. They're saying "look at what I did....look at what I accomplished". In the same manner, those who are God's Elect are called Trophies of Grace. We are put on display for others to see. Jesus can point to us and say "look at what I did.....look at what I accomplished". It is to HIS GLORY ALONE that we are called....that we are saved. So if it is based on our will that we are saved, if it is OUR decision to accept Christ, who gets the glory??? Well, then WE would get the glory. But it's not the case. It is through God's own good will and pleasure that we are saved and HE gets all the glory.
So our salvation does come through Scripture Alone, by Grace Alone, through Faith Alone, in Christ Alone, to the Glory of God Alone.....Period!
